The Character will have 4 Movement States, Idle Stand, Walk, Run and Sprint. Running-Walking can be toggled and sprinting works only when the Shift Key is beeing pressed.
The Movement Speed of the Character will be varying from -600 to 800 in Unreal Units. With the use of 2D Blendspace, we can get a unique Animation by blending Idle, Walk, Run, Sprint Animations downloaded from Mixamo.
